Hannah Lynn Storen Hicks [1] [2] (born June 13, 1962), [3] known professionally as Hannah Storm, is an American television sports journalist, serving as the anchor of ESPN 's SportsCenter. She was also host of the NBA Countdown pregame show on ABC as part of the network's National Basketball Association (NBA) Sunday game coverage.

Her rise has continued ever since, anchoring SportsCenter and hosting/reporting on their ...Nicole Briscoe became a SportsCenter anchor and studio show host in early 2015 after working in various roles in ESPN's NASCAR coverage from 2008-2014. She is most often seen on the 11 p.m. ET edition. Her studio show duties include regularly hosting Baseball Tonight: Sunday Night Countdown leading into ESPN's Sunday Night Baseball.. Doris Burke is a female NBA announcer, analyst and reporter. She has been an NBA journalist for over three decades and was inducted into the Basketball Hall of Fame. She covers the NBA on ESPN and ABC.
